As the name suggests, Kalong Rinca is a place where we can enjoy the sunset in the middle of the ocean, with a backdrop of small hills and the setting sun. However, the main attraction of this destination is the nocturnal animals that are endemic to Kalong Island. Thousands of migrating bats will fly over the rows of parked Pinishi ships to enjoy the beauty of the sunset. Jumbo-sized bats will fly around you in search of food at night. The combination of the red sky at sunset and thousands of flying bats, as well as the rows of Pinishi parked in the middle of the ocean, is a unique sight and a rare moment that you can enjoy as the end of today's trip.
Padar Island is the opening destination for the second day. We will wake you up at 5 am to start your journey by climbing Padar Hill. No need to worry about the word "climbing," we will only take you up the stairs that have been prepared by the Komodo National Park Management to make it easier for us to reach the top of Padar. A little tired and maybe your legs are weak, but all of that will disappear immediately when you reach the top of Padar and witness the beauty of the sunrise and the side of Padar Island Beach which has different sand colors. There are 3 colors of sand on the 3 sides of Padar Island, namely white sand, black sand, and pink sand. The fresh and cool air in this place makes you feel at home to linger in this place. Pink Beach, or Long Beach. As the name suggests, this beach is the longest beach we visited during our two-night sailing trip. Another well-known name is Pink Beach. This name comes from the color of the sand, which is mixed with fragments of red coral that have been destroyed by the waves and weather, forming red grains of sand. This combination of red coral and white sand creates a pink silhouette when viewed from a distance or under the scorching sun. Besides the color of the sand, the underwater world here is also quite beautiful. You can swim or snorkel here, or sunbathe on the sand while enjoying a young coconut. Taka Makasar is a lost island swept away by abrasion, leaving only a sandbar in the open ocean. The island disappears at high tide and reappears at low tide. At Taka Makasar, you can take a break and enjoy the afternoon atmosphere while waiting for the sunset. The air here is fresh and pollution-free.
